protected void createSpeedFiltersEntry(
      Composite parent, FormToolkit toolkit, IActionBars actionBars) {
    SWTUtil.createLabel(parent, StringPool.EMPTY, 1);

    GridData td = new GridData();
    td.horizontalSpan = 5;

    speedFilters = toolkit.createButton(parent, Msgs.speedFilters, SWT.CHECK);

    speedFilters.setLayoutData(td);
    speedFilters.setEnabled(isEditable());
    speedFilters.addSelectionListener(
        new SelectionAdapter() {

          public void widgetSelected(SelectionEvent e) {
            if (!speedFilterEnabledModifying) {
              getModel().setSpeedFiltersEnabled(speedFilters.getSelection());
            }
          }
        });
  }
  protected void createContentFolderGroup(Composite topComposite) {
    Composite composite = SWTUtil.createTopComposite(topComposite, 3);

    GridLayout gl = new GridLayout(3, false);
    gl.marginLeft = 5;

    composite.setLayout(gl);
    composite.setLayoutData(new GridData(SWT.FILL, SWT.CENTER, true, false, 3, 1));

    SWTUtil.createLabel(composite, SWT.LEAD, Msgs.contentFolder, 1);

    contentFolder = SWTUtil.createText(composite, 1);
    this.synchHelper.synchText(contentFolder, CONTENT_FOLDER, null);

    Button iconFileBrowse = SWTUtil.createPushButton(composite, Msgs.browse, null);
    iconFileBrowse.addSelectionListener(
        new SelectionAdapter() {

          @Override
          public void widgetSelected(SelectionEvent e) {
            handleFileBrowseButton(NewLanguagePropertiesHookWizardPage.this.contentFolder);
          }
        });
  }